vscode c文件 变量颜色
时间: 2024-03-29 19:37:46 浏览: 50
在 VS Code 中,可以通过安装 C/C++ 插件来获得更好的代码高亮和语法检查功能。在安装完插件后,打开一个 C 文件,你会发现变量名会有不同的颜色,这是因为 C/C++ 插件会根据变量的作用域以及类型等信息来区分颜色,以便更好地帮助我们理解代码。例如,局部变量会使用不同于全局变量的颜色,指针类型的变量也会使用不同的颜色等等。如果你想修改颜色,可以在 VS Code 的设置中搜索 "C/C++",然后在 "C/C++: Semantic Token Colors" 中进行修改。
相关问题
vscode怎么设置全局变量颜色
在Visual Studio Code (VSCode) 中,你可以通过编辑配置文件来设置全局变量和注释的颜色。以下是两个相关的部分:
1. **更改变量和选中区域颜色**[^1]:
- 打开VSCode,点击左上角的`File`菜单,选择`Preferences` > `Settings`,或者直接按`Ctrl + ,`(Windows/Linux)或`Cmd + ,`(Mac)打开`settings.json`文件。
- 在设置中添加如下内容,以定制选中变量背景和高亮颜色:
```json
"workbench.colorCustomizations": {
"editor.selectionBackground": "#d1d1c6",
"editor.selectionHighlightBackground": "#c5293e"
}
```
这里你可以替换`#d1d1c6`和`#c5293e`为你喜欢的颜色代码。
2. **个性化注释颜色**:
- 同样在`settings.json`中找到`editor.tokenColorCustomizations`部分,添加对`comments`颜色的自定义:
```json
"editor.tokenColorCustomizations": {
"comments": "#82e0aa"
}
```
将`#82e0aa`替换为你喜欢的注释颜色代码。
完成上述设置后,重启VSCode,新设置就会生效。
vscode c/c++结构体变量颜色
如果您想在 VS Code 中为结构体变量设置颜色,可以使用 C/C++ 扩展中的“C_Cpp.structMemberColor”设置。您可以按照以下步骤进行操作:
1. 打开 VS Code 并进入用户首选项(Settings)。
2. 在搜索栏中输入“C_Cpp.structMemberColor”。
3. 点击“Edit in settings.json”以编辑用户设置文件。
4. 在设置文件中找到“C_Cpp.structMemberColor”并设置您喜欢的颜色,例如:
```json
"C_Cpp.structMemberColor": "#FF0000"
```
5. 保存设置并重新启动 VS Code。
这样,您的结构体变量将以您选择的颜色显示。
阅读全文